"A fuller picture" was produced independently by two NCF Executive members.

 

About "A fuller picture". In July 2008 this was a response to the BERR consultation which led to the BIS ( formally BERR ) white paper "A better deal for consumers July 2009" listed above. "A fuller picture" is not specifically about the credit crunch but it does analyse many factors relevant to consumer protection which also arise from the credit crunch. Issues such as self regulation, what regulatory authorities should monitor for maximum effectiveness and consumer representation and consultation.
